2026-03-23 14:57:47 +08:00

11 lines
4.5 KiB
JavaScript

require('./common/vendor.js');(global["webpackJsonp"]=global["webpackJsonp"]||[]).push([["subpackage/diyComponents/homeReviews"],{"036d":function(t,n,i){"use strict";Object.defineProperty(n,"__esModule",{value:!0}),n.default=void 0;var o=i("8ede"),e={components:{commonWrapper:function(){i.e("subpackage/diyComponents/commonWrapper").then(function(){return resolve(i("11450"))}.bind(null,i)).catch(i.oe)}},name:"homeReviews",props:{dataConfig:{type:Object,default:function(){return{}}},productId:{type:[Number,String],default:0},reply:{type:Array,default:function(){return[]}},replyCount:{type:[Number,String],default:0},replyChance:{type:[Number,String],default:0}},data:function(){return{replyList:[]}},watch:{productId:{handler:function(t){t&&this.getReplyListFun()},immediate:!0},dataConfig:{handler:function(t){t&&this.productId&&this.getReplyListFun()},deep:!0}},computed:{configData:function(){return this.dataConfig},bgRadius:function(){if(!this.dataConfig.fillet)return{};var t="".concat(2*this.dataConfig.fillet.val,"rpx");return this.dataConfig.fillet.type&&(t="".concat(2*this.dataConfig.fillet.valList[0].val,"rpx ").concat(2*this.dataConfig.fillet.valList[1].val,"rpx ").concat(2*this.dataConfig.fillet.valList[3].val,"rpx ").concat(2*this.dataConfig.fillet.valList[2].val,"rpx")),{borderRadius:t,overflow:"hidden"}},checkList:function(){return this.dataConfig.checkBoxConfig?this.dataConfig.checkBoxConfig.type:[]},isSlide:function(){return!!this.dataConfig.layoutConfig&&1===this.dataConfig.layoutConfig.tabVal},showList:function(){return this.replyList},titleColor:function(){return this.dataConfig.titleColor&&this.dataConfig.titleColor.color[0]?this.dataConfig.titleColor.color[0].item:"#333333"},countColor:function(){return this.dataConfig.countColor&&this.dataConfig.countColor.color[0]?this.dataConfig.countColor.color[0].item:"#999999"},rateColor:function(){return this.dataConfig.toneConfig&&1===this.dataConfig.toneConfig.tabVal?this.dataConfig.rateColor&&this.dataConfig.rateColor.color[0]?this.dataConfig.rateColor.color[0].item:"#E93323":"var(--view-theme)"},starColor:function(){return this.dataConfig.toneConfig&&1===this.dataConfig.toneConfig.tabVal?this.dataConfig.starColor&&this.dataConfig.starColor.color[0]?this.dataConfig.starColor.color[0].item:"#E93323":"var(--view-theme)"},totalCount:function(){return this.replyCount||"0"}},methods:{getReplyListFun:function(){var t=this,n=this.dataConfig.numConfig?this.dataConfig.numConfig.val:2;(0,o.getReplyList)(this.productId,{page:1,limit:n,type:0}).then((function(n){t.replyList=n.data||[]}))}}};n.default=e},"13b5":function(t,n,i){},6306:function(t,n,i){"use strict";i.d(n,"b",(function(){return o})),i.d(n,"c",(function(){return e})),i.d(n,"a",(function(){}));var o=function(){var t=this,n=t.$createElement,i=(t._self._c,t.replyList.length),o=i>0?t.__get_style([t.bgRadius]):null,e=i>0?t.$t("评价"):null,a=i>0?t.checkList.includes(0):null,r=i>0?t.checkList.includes(1):null,l=i>0&&r?t.$t("好评率"):null,u=i>0&&!t.isSlide?t.__map(t.showList,(function(n,i){var o=t.__get_orig(n),e=n.pics&&n.pics.length,a=e?t.__map(n.pics.slice(0,3),(function(i,o){var e=t.__get_orig(i),a=2===o&&n.pics.length>3,r=a?n.pics.length:null;return{$orig:e,g4:a,g5:r}})):null;return{$orig:o,g3:e,l0:a}})):null,c=i>0&&t.isSlide?t.__map(t.showList,(function(n,i){var o=t.__get_orig(n),e=n.pics&&n.pics.length,a=e?t.__map(n.pics.slice(0,3),(function(i,o){var e=t.__get_orig(i),a=2===o&&n.pics.length>3,r=a?n.pics.length:null;return{$orig:e,g7:a,g8:r}})):null;return{$orig:o,g6:e,l2:a}})):null;t.$mp.data=Object.assign({},{$root:{g0:i,s0:o,m0:e,g1:a,g2:r,m1:l,l1:u,l3:c}})},e=[]},"850a":function(t,n,i){"use strict";i.r(n);var o=i("036d"),e=i.n(o);for(var a in o)["default"].indexOf(a)<0&&function(t){i.d(n,t,(function(){return o[t]}))}(a);n["default"]=e.a},cc5d:function(t,n,i){"use strict";i.r(n);var o=i("6306"),e=i("850a");for(var a in e)["default"].indexOf(a)<0&&function(t){i.d(n,t,(function(){return e[t]}))}(a);i("e9bf");var r=i("828b"),l=Object(r["a"])(e["default"],o["b"],o["c"],!1,null,"eef7a5f0",null,!1,o["a"],void 0);n["default"]=l.exports},e9bf:function(t,n,i){"use strict";var o=i("13b5"),e=i.n(o);e.a}}]);
;(global["webpackJsonp"] = global["webpackJsonp"] || []).push([
'subpackage/diyComponents/homeReviews-create-component',
{
'subpackage/diyComponents/homeReviews-create-component':(function(module, exports, __webpack_require__){
__webpack_require__('df3c')['createComponent'](__webpack_require__("cc5d"))
})
},
[['subpackage/diyComponents/homeReviews-create-component']]
]);